Original Description
The portrait Elisabeth Charlotte of the Palatinate, Duchess of Orleans, and Her Children by Jean Gilbert Murat captures a moment of aristocratic elegance infused with familial warmth. Painted in the late Baroque period, the work exemplifies the refined portraiture favored by European nobility, blending regal poise with subtle emotional depth. Murat's meticulous brushwork renders the luxurious fabrics and intricate lace with lifelike precision, while the soft interplay of light and shadow enhances the dignified yet tender atmosphere. Elisabeth Charlotte, a historically significant figure as the second wife of Philippe I, Duke of Orleans, is depicted with her children, embodying maternal grace and courtly stature. The painting holds a notable place in art history as a testament to 17th-century French portraiture, reflecting both the cultural ideals of the era and the personal dynamics of the Orleans family. Its composition—balanced yet dynamic—echoes the influence of contemporaries like Rigaud, while Murat's distinctive touch lends it uniqueness.
